New prescription for nitroglycerin. The nurse should instruct the client that which of the
following manifestations is a potential adverse effect of this medication? - ANSWER-
Headache
New prescriptions with a client who has heart disease. The nurse should instruct the
client that which of the following medications is prescribed to treat hyper
cholesterolemia? - ANSWER-Simvastatin
New prescription for losartan to treat hypertension. The nurse should instruct the client
that which of the following findings could indicate an adverse reaction to the medication
and needs reported? - ANSWER-Facial edema
New prescription for verapamil. The nurse should clarify the prescription with the
provider if the client has a history of which of the following conditions? - ANSWER-
Second-Degree AV block

Client who is taking a diuretic. The nurse should instruct the client to include which of
the following foods in their diet to increase potassium intake? - ANSWER-Raisins
New prescription for verapamil to treat atrial fibrillation. The nurse should instruct the
client to avoid drinking grapefruit juice while taking verapamil because it can cause the
client to experience which of the following conditions? - ANSWER-Hypotension
Transdermal nitroglycerin to treat angina pectorals. When speaking to the client about
the medication, which of the following instructions should the nurse include? -
ANSWER-Apply the patch to a hairless area and rotate sites
Apply a new patch when you start your day
Remove patches for 10 to 12 hrs each day
